Prayer of Confession

Almighty and most merciful God, we acknowledge and confess that we have sinned against you in thought, word, and deed; that we have not loved you with all our heart and soul, with all our mind and strength, and that we have not loved our neighbor as ourselves. We beseech you, O God, to forgive what we have been, to help us to amend what we are, and of your mercy to direct what we shall be, so that we may hereafter walk in the way of your commandments, and do those things which are pleasing in your sight, through Jesus Christ our Lord. Amen.

Confession of Faith: Westminster Shorter Catechism, question 27

Question: Wherein did Christ’s humiliation consist?
Answer: Christ’s humiliation consisted in his being born, and that in a low condition, made under the law, undergoing the miseries of this life, the wrath of God, and the cursed death of the cross; in being buried, and continuing under the power of death for a time.
